An AI-generated Granny baffles and bedevils phone scammers across the UK. The US collectively freaks out as unidentified swarms of drones appear over multiple cities. Some Russian politicians want to declare Santa a foreign agent. The largest supermarket merger in history goes sour in court, with Albertsons calling off the merger and suing Kroger. Russia sends an elite force to North Korea -- not 100 soldiers, but 100 top-tier goats. All this and more in this week's strange news segment.
